
DAMAULI, TANAHUN: Alternative routes via Khairenitar and Damauli are providing vital relief to thousands of travellers stranded by recent landslides near Tuinkhola on the Muglin–Narayangadh road.
One key detour runs from Damauli to Dedgaun via Khairenitar in Tanahun. The Gandaki Province Government has been constructing this link as a flagship project to connect Mustang with Tarai, although it remains suitable only for small and light vehicles.
Local commuter Prakash Chandra Bhattarai, who used the Khairenitar route recently, said motorists could drive from Damauli through Khairenitar, then follow the Bhimad–Manpur road to reach Dedgaun, Bulingtar, Dhodeni and Gaindakot.
The full distances are: Muglin to Khairenitar, 70 km; Khairenitar to Bhimad (blacktop), 7 km; Bhimad to Manpur (dirt), 35 km; Manpur to Dedgaun (blacktop), 40 km; and Dedgaun to Narayangadh, 70 km.
Motorcyclists can also cross the suspension bridge from Damauli through Keshavtar, Sukhaura, Huslang and Dharampani to rejoin the Muglin–Narayangadh section, according to local resident Vijay Rana.
